“My practice began as an attempt to discover myself. Over time, it continues to evolve as an inner journey. I am drawn to spiritual and mystical, not as distant ideas but as lived experiences that unfold quietly in everyday life. Looking especially within Sufi traditions, not to illustrate them, but to sit with the questions they open. My work is less about telling stories and more about creating spaces for reflection — where what is hidden or in between can be
felt instead of explained.

Rather than anchoring my practice in fixed symbols or narratives, I approach each piece as a process of reflection— a way to listen, to unearth, and to translate what cannot be spoken. The act of making becomes a way of engaging with questions that shape both my inner world and the reality around me where personal contemplation meets human experiences.In this way, the work remains open, allowing meaning to surface gradually — not as a conclusion, but as ongoing search. Silence, uncertainty and transformations are not themes but a state of being I try to hold within my work.

For this show , I explored the idea of suspension through forms untethered from ground, time, and certainty.Each piece exists in a delicate state between stillness and drift, belonging and isolation.These works dwell in moments that refuse resolution.

Stones, birds, and fragments linger in quiet states of transition, solitude, and becoming.” - Ramsha Haider

Passage (عبور ) I, II & III - Triptych
Gouache, silver and 24K goldleaf on wasli
21 x 10 inches
2026

“Playing on a contrast between intricate detail and flat patches of colour, between a tumbling together of texture and pattern and pallid faces, my practice consists of works that borrow from ancient and modern family photographs to create compositions that are reminiscent of dreamscapes. My paintings seek to create an otherworldly, almost liminal space - where women interact, reflect, and go about their daily rituals. The skewed compositions and natural elements seek inspiration from Mughal and Persian miniature paintings, while the mystery and privacy of nighttime has been used as the backdrop for these strange scenes based on inward wanderings and experiences of womanhood. Visual elements from memory and dream come together to create a patchwork of imagery and like most dreams, oddities occur - slight instances of glitches in the fabric of the narrative. Strange birds, animals and flora make an appearance, as if magnified and made eccentric by memory. Each work is a nod to some aspect of South Asian femaleness, and elements of love, longing, transformation and introspection remain at the forefront.“ - Khadijah Rehman

Dirge | Gouache, inks and confetti stars on paper, foil and ceramic plate
| 8 inches diameter | 2026
Deluge | Gouache, inks and confetti stars on paper and ceramic plate
| 6 inches diameter | 2026

We’re so thankful to everybody who attended the opening of “Inward Wanderings”

Inward Wanderings opened on Saturday, June 5, 2026, and will remain up on display until Monday June 15, 2026.

Inward Wanderings explores the relationship between interiority and lived experience through the work of two artists whose practices are rooted in reflection, memory, and personal inquiry. While differing in approach, both artists examine the ways in which private contemplation intersects with broader human experience.

Moving between dream and reality, the seen and the unseen, the exhibition considers introspection as a generative space—one where memory, spirituality, emotion, and imagination shape our understanding of the world. The works resist fixed narratives, instead creating moments of pause that invite viewers into states of reflection and discovery.

Together, these works form a visual landscape of inward exploration, revealing the richness and complexity of experiences that often unfold quietly beneath the surface of everyday life.
